HC Deb 05 August 1975 vol 897 c112W
Mr. Wigley

asked the Secretary of State for the Environment what correspondence he has received from district councils in Gwynedd during the past month relative to rate support grants; and what reply he has sent.

Mr. Oakes

My Department has received a letter dated 20th June from Ynys Mon Borough Council about the effect on the council's finances of a possible reduction in the rating assessment of a large hereditament in its area. The Department replied on 2nd July, explaining the statutory provisions governing the calculation of the resources element of rate support grant and setting out the circumstances in which a significant reduction in an authority's aggregate effective rateable value would be taken into account in a recalculation of the resources element payable to the authority.
